Preston park to turn 'sea of crimson' for flashmob in honour of Kate Bush classic

Thanks to Netflix smash hit show Stranger Things, Kate Bush's pop anthem Running Up That Hill rocketed up the charts out of nowhere, dominating fan and radio playlists. The song was featured on one episode in the fourth season of the 80s-set supernatural TV phenomenon.

Kate Bush fans are invited to take part in The Most Wuthering Heights Day Ever at Avenham and Miller Park on Sunday, July 30. The mass-dance event will mark the song's 45-year anniversary.Those taking part will be asked to wear red and follow professional dancers who will lead the flashmob-style routine to the famously-captivating song. It is designed to include people of all dance abilities and ages.

Organisers hope to fill the park with a "sea of crimson" and that people are keen to take part in "something a bit silly". Helen Frost, one of the organisers, said: "I first saw the videos on social media – so I thought, why not make it happen in Preston?
